Art Forms and Craftsmanship:
The tribes of Kabini are renowned for their remarkable art forms and craftsmanship. Pottery, one of their prominent art forms, showcases their exceptional skill in shaping clay into beautiful and functional vessels. The pottery designs often incorporate intricate patterns and symbols that hold cultural significance, reflecting the stories and beliefs passed down through generations.

Basket weaving is another craft mastered by the indigenous tribes of Kabini. They skillfully weave sustainable materials like bamboo and natural fibres into sturdy and visually appealing baskets.
